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ership


He Jun, VP at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co. Ltd. (TSM), reported the acquisition of 49 American Depositary Shares through the company's Employee Stock Purchase Plan.

Summary

  • He Jun, a Vice President at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co. Ltd. (TSM), has reported a transaction involving the acquisition of securities.
  • On May 8, 2026, He Jun acquired 49 American Depositary Shares (ADS) of TSM.
  • This acquisition was made through the company's Employee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P) at a price of $71.82 per ADS.
  • Following this transaction, He Jun beneficially owns 5,224 ADS, held indirectly through the ESPP Trust.
  • The filing also notes other holdings, including 120,119 Common Shares (2330.TW) held directly, 302 ADS (TSM) held directly, 852 ADS (TSM) held directly, 216 ADS (TSM) held indirectly by spouse, and 7,036 Common Shares (2330.TW) held indirectly by LTI Trust.
